Understanding Nighttime Leg Pain Causes

To effectively find **nighttime leg pain management** solutions, it's vital to first understand the underlying causes of discomfort. Nighttime leg pain can be attributed to several factors, including poor circulation, muscle cramps, or conditions involving nerve pain. Conditions such as Restless Leg Syndrome (RLS) or **arthritis and leg pain** issues can contribute significantly as well. Major influences include **leg pain from sitting** for extended periods or obesity, which puts additional stress on the legs, causing **muscle strain recovery** delays during the night.

Common Triggers for Nighttime Leg Pain

In many cases, leg pain at night arises from common triggers like dehydration and inadequate nutrition. A lack of magnesium and calcium can lead to painful leg cramps, particularly during your sleep. Ensuring proper hydration and considering a **diet for leg health** can considerably reduce the risk. Sometimes, simple changes such as altering your **sitting posture** or avoiding tight-fitting clothing can significantly affect blood circulation, further impacting your **leg pain and circulation** health.

Stretching Exercises: A Step Towards Comfort

Engaging in targeted **stretching exercises for legs** is a proactive method to alleviate severe leg pain. Consider gentle movements like calf stretches, hamstring stretches, or even yoga routines designed for leg health. A yoga pose such as the **Downward Dog** not only stretches the calves and hamstrings but also promotes blood circulation. By incorporating these activities into your routine, you help prepare your legs to endure prolonged periods of rest without the onset of pain.

Heat and Cold Therapy

Utilizing **heat therapy for legs** or cold compress treatments can be particularly effective in relieving pain sensations. Warm baths, hot water bottles, or electric heating pads help soothe aching muscles and improve circulation, whereas a **cold compress for leg pain** can reduce swelling and numb pain receptors. Alternating between heat and cold therapy is an effective way to manage discomfort quickly and should be tailored based on individual preference and pain responses.

Over-the-Counter and Prescription Options

Among the many tools in the toolbox for **severe leg pain treatment**, **over-the-counter pain relief** can provide immediate effects. Acetaminophen and ibuprofen are suitable for acute episodes, while long-term solutions may involve prescription-strength options prescribed by a doctor. Careful consideration of your symptoms will determine what treatment best fits your needs, balancing your level of discomfort with individual health circumstances.

2. How can hydration impact leg pain?

Staying adequately hydrated plays a crucial role in preventing **muscle cramps** and promoting overall leg health. Dehydration can lead to electrolyte imbalances, increasing the likelihood of experiencing severe leg pain at night. Ensure daily fluid intake and include foods rich in water content to maintain optimal hydration levels.
